Ohio employs 1,200 structural metal fabricators and fitters. The highest concentrations are in Cleveland and Dayton-Kettering-Beavercreek.
Structural Metal Fabricators and Fitters salary by metro area in Ohio
| Metro area | Median | Hourly | Employment |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cleveland | $56K | $26.85/hr | 120 |
| Dayton-Kettering-Beavercreek | $53K | $25.31/hr | 50 |
| Columbus | $51K | $24.42/hr | 200 |
| Canton-Massillon | $51K | $24.33/hr | 80 |
| Cincinnati | $50K | $24.06/hr | 210 |
| Akron | $50K | $23.98/hr | 50 |
| Youngstown-Warren | $49K | $23.43/hr | 50 |

How much does a structural metal fabricators and fitters make in Ohio?▼
The median structural metal fabricators and fitters salary in Ohio is $51,190 per year ($24.61/hr). This is 3% above the national median of $49,900. Salaries range from $40,430 to $58,960.

Can a structural metal fabricators and fitters afford to live in Ohio?▼
At the median salary of $51,190, a structural metal fabricators and fitters in Ohio would take home approximately $3,539/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$1,412/month, that's 39.9% of take-home pay going to housing. This exceeds the recommended 30% guideline.
What are the best cities for structural metal fabricators and fitters in Ohio?▼
The highest paying metro areas for structural metal fabricators and fitters in Ohio are Cleveland ($55,850), Dayton-Kettering-Beavercreek ($52,640), Columbus ($50,800). However, cost of living varies significantly between metros — a higher salary may not mean more purchasing power.
